A company called Exmovere has unveiled a sensor-laden set of PJs for baby called Exmobaby that is designed to help parents rest knowing the baby is fine and help mom and dad monitor kids that might be at risk for SIDS.
The PJs have sensors that are placed to monitor the heart rate and emotional state of the baby along with behavior. The sensors use Zigbee wireless protocols to communicate with some sort of monitor. If the heart rate drops or stops the parents will know and can hopefully save the child.
